Managing HMI Spare Parts for Long-Term System Continuity

The HMIGXU3512 is an active product, but that status does not eliminate supply risk. Schneider Electric's product lifecycle management means that any given HMI model can transition from active to last-time-buy to discontinued within a 3–5 year window — often with limited advance notice to end users. For plant managers operating facilities with a 10–20 year asset horizon, this creates a structural problem: the automation hardware was specified and installed when the product was current, but the facility's operational life extends well beyond the manufacturer's commercial support window.

The practical strategy used by experienced maintenance engineers is straightforward: identify the HMI panels that are single points of failure on critical lines, calculate the cost of one unplanned downtime event caused by panel failure, and compare that figure against the cost of holding one or two spare units. In most industrial environments, the math resolves in favor of stocking spares within the first calculation. A single 4-hour production stoppage on a mid-volume manufacturing line typically exceeds the cost of two spare HMI panels by a factor of 5–10x.

For facilities running Modicon-based control architectures, the HMIGXU3512 is frequently the operator interface layer connecting floor personnel to the underlying PLC logic. Replacing it with a different HMI model is not a simple swap — it requires Vijeo Designer project migration, screen layout redesign, tag remapping, and operator retraining. The engineering cost of that substitution, even on a straightforward application, routinely runs $15,000–$40,000 when consultant time, validation, and lost production during commissioning are included. Holding a like-for-like spare eliminates that cost entirely.

Condition & Reliability Assurance

Every HMIGXU3512 unit shipped by DriveKNMS passes a structured 5-step inspection protocol before dispatch:

  • Step 1 – Visual and Mechanical Inspection: Enclosure integrity, connector pin condition, and touchscreen surface are examined for physical damage, corrosion, or contamination. Units with pin oxidation or housing cracks are rejected at this stage.
  • Step 2 – Electrolytic Capacitor Assessment: Aging electrolytic capacitors are a primary failure mode in HMI panels stored beyond 3–5 years. Capacitor condition is assessed; units showing bulging, leakage, or ESR deviation are flagged and not shipped as standard replacements.
  • Step 3 – Firmware Version Verification: Firmware version is documented and disclosed to the buyer prior to shipment. Compatibility with the customer's existing Vijeo Designer project version is confirmed where project details are provided.
  • Step 4 – Power-On Functional Test: The unit is powered and verified to boot correctly, display output is confirmed, and touchscreen calibration is checked.
  • Step 5 – Packaging and ESD Protection: Units are packed in anti-static bags with foam cushioning. Shipping method is selected based on destination and urgency requirements.
